前回のDIコンテナの記事から4ヶ月ほど経ち、だいたい今まで書いた記事も役に立たなくなった感じですね。とりあえず最近Symfony2でコード書いてて思ったことをメモしておきます。 Form 1系の鬼門だったFormですが、ずいぶんよくなりました。今度Symfony2勉強会で発表予定。 Security おそらく2系の鬼門。とりあえずFirewallの流れ。 URLをベースにFirewallの特定(Firewall, FirewallMap) ContextListener: SessionとTokenの管理 トークンはセッションに格納されるが、デフォルトではEntityもシリアライズの対象 セッションにデータが入っていた場合でも、再度DBへアクセスしてデータをロード LogoutListener: ログアウト UsernamePasswordFormAuthenticationListene